/* * Copyright 2009 Google Inc. *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 package com.google.template.soy.basicfunctions; import com.google.common.collect.ImmutableSet; import com.google.template.soy.data.SoyValue; import com.google.template.soy.data.restricted.FloatData; import com.google.template.soy.data.restricted.IntegerData; import com.google.template.soy.data.restricted.NumberData; import com.google.template.soy.jssrc.restricted.JsExpr; import com.google.template.soy.jssrc.restricted.SoyJsSrcFunction; import com.google.template.soy.pysrc.restricted.PyExpr; import com.google.template.soy.pysrc.restricted.PyFunctionExprBuilder; import com.google.template.soy.pysrc.restricted.SoyPySrcFunction; import com.google.template.soy.shared.restricted.SoyJavaFunction; import com.google.template.soy.shared.restricted.SoyPureFunction; import java.util.List; import java.util.Set; import javax.inject.Inject; import javax.inject.Singleton; /** * Soy function that takes the min of two numbers. * */ @Singleton @SoyPureFunction public final class MinFunction implements SoyJavaFunction, SoyJsSrcFunction, SoyPySrcFunction { @Inject MinFunction() {} @Override public String getName() { return "min"; } @Override public Set<Integer> getValidArgsSizes() { return ImmutableSet.of(2); } @Override public SoyValue computeForJava(List<SoyValue> args) { SoyValue arg0 = args.get(0); SoyValue arg1 = args.get(1); return min(arg0, arg1); } /** Returns the numeric minimum of the two arguments. */ public static NumberData min(SoyValue arg0, SoyValue arg1) { if (arg0 instanceof IntegerData && arg1 instanceof IntegerData) { return IntegerData.forValue(Math.min(arg0.longValue(), arg1.longValue())); } else { return FloatData.forValue(Math.min(arg0.numberValue(), arg1.numberValue())); } } @Override public JsExpr computeForJsSrc(List<JsExpr> args) { JsExpr arg0 = args.get(0); JsExpr arg1 = args.get(1); return new JsExpr( "Math.min(" + arg0.getText() + ", " + arg1.getText() + ")", Integer.MAX_VALUE); } @Override public PyExpr computeForPySrc(List<PyExpr> args) { PyExpr arg0 = args.get(0); PyExpr arg1 = args.get(1); PyFunctionExprBuilder fnBuilder = new PyFunctionExprBuilder("min"); return fnBuilder.addArg(arg0).addArg(arg1).asPyExpr(); } }
